Modern veterinary science recognizes that physiology and behavior are deeply intertwined. Stress, fear, and anxiety trigger physiological responses—such as elevated cortisol, high blood pressure, and suppressed immune function—that actively hinder medical healing. Consequently, behavioral evaluation is now standard practice in comprehensive veterinary diagnostics. 2. One of the darkest statistics in veterinary medicine is the rate of euthanasia in young, physically healthy animals. Across the United States and Europe, behavioral issues—not medical ones—remain the number one cause of death for dogs and cats under three years old.
